Different tools, same diagnosis? A comparison of digital orthodontic model analysis methods: A retrospective cross-sectional study.

Abstract
INTRODUCTION
To evaluate the reliability and between-method agreement of a freely available orthodontic model analysis software (FusionAnalyser) against a commercial platform (OrthoAnalyzer™) and conventional digital calliper measurements on plaster casts.
MATERIAL AND
Methods
In this retrospective cross-sectional study, pre-treatment records of 40 patients collected between 2022 and 2025 were analysed by two examiners, each performing measurements twice at least 15 days apart. Mesiodistal tooth widths, Bolton ratios, and arch space deficiency were measured by all three methods. Intra- and inter-rater reliability were assessed using intraclass correlation coefficients and Dahlberg errors; between-method agreement was assessed with Friedman and Wilcoxon signed-rank tests, and Bland-Altman analyses with predefined clinical thresholds (±0.50mm for tooth widths, ±1.50 percentage points for Bolton ratios, ±1.00mm for arch space deficiency).
Results
Of 52 records screened, 40 met the eligibility criteria and were included. ICC values across all methods and both examiners ranged from 0.74 (95% CI 0.56-0.86) to 0.996 (95% CI 0.993-0.998). Between-method differences in mesiodistal tooth widths were small (mostly 0.10-0.30mm) and remained within the ±0.50mm threshold. Limits of agreement for the anterior Bolton ratio exceeded ±1.50 percentage points across all comparisons. For mandibular arch space deficiency, 100% of FusionAnalyser-versus-calliper differences fell within ±1.00mm (mean difference 0.20mm, 95% CI 0.12-0.29); agreement in the maxillary arch was marginally lower but clinically acceptable.
Conclusion
The free orthodontic software produced tooth-width and arch space deficiency measurements clinically comparable to those of the commercial platform and within clinically acceptable agreement limits of plaster-cast calliper measurements. Bolton ratio agreement was less interchangeable due to the cumulative aggregation of small per-tooth errors. These findings support the adoption of freely available orthodontics-specific software, particularly where commercial licensing is a barrier.
